With the new BT homehubs, you need to go into the "advanced" settings, to see your Broadband IP address and manage your wireless setup
- Open Internet Browser
- Navigate to http://192.168.1.254
- Enter your password that you have specified, or the primary one generated when you got it and haven't changed yet (it will be on back of the router on a sticker), if you have forgotten you can reset the router by pushing the button then it will go to the one on the back sticker
- Click on advanced settings
- Broadband tab has the WAN IP info (or you can go to ipchicken.com)
- Wireless TAB gives you settings for Wireless (security, key, channel, etc)
